Strategic planning for optimal development of aquaculture in coastal areas of Qeshm Island

Abstract
The economic growing of aquaculture and dependence of a large amount of growing population to coastal resource has led to coastal degradation and reduced resources. In this paper while realizing the potential capacities of the islands systems, it's specially discusses the activities of aquaculture in the framework of Integrated Coastal Zone Management (ICZM). Therefore, in this study, firstly, the environment's internal strategic factors (strengths and weaknesses) and external factors (opportunities and threats) were identified. Thereafter, Analytic Network Process (ANP) and Super Decision Software in SWOT matrix were used to evaluate and prioritize these factors, as well as to develop several proposed strategies. Using a designed network model, the proposed strategies were weighted and the main strategies of the evaluation matrix were ranked. In this study, the Qeshm Island as the largest island in the Persian Gulf was identified as the study area. The results showed that the most efficient strategies to optimal development of aquaculture use of coastal areas of Qeshm Island are: strategies of Using objectives, policies, plans of aquaculture and hunting Aquatic to build and strengthen of sustainable aquaculture these users in the region, Building and strengthening comprehensive aquaculture plan for conservation of natural marine resources in the framework of ICZM, Creating and development of infrastructure facilities and infrastructure aquaculture in order to create optimum user of the lands, Allocate adequate funding to achieve conservation programs and user development of aquaculture and environmental protection involved in (ST) strategies.
